
TOKYO–(BUSINESS WIRE)–Sevensix Inc. (Headquarters: Minato-ku, Tokyo; CEO: Yosuke Hane) is pleased to announce the full-scale launch of its proprietary optical frequency comb generator, Frush, in the U.S. market starting October 2025.
Frush is a next-generation optical platform that enables the generation of optical frequency combs—essential for advanced optical communications, quantum optics, and precision spectroscopy—with remarkably simple operation. Designed for both research and industrial environments, Frush delivers exceptional reliability and repeatability. The system has already earned strong endorsements from leading universities and research institutions in Japan and abroad.

Features
Frush is a highly reliable and robust EO-based optical comb generator that utilizes a single dual-drive Mach-Zehnder modulator combined with Sevensix’s proprietary auto-bias control system. With turnkey operation, Frush generates a stable optical frequency comb spectrum within just 10 seconds of startup.
Frush accepts two external signal sources—a narrow-linewidth laser and an RF signal generator—allowing users to fully leverage their existing equipment. This enables the generation of optical frequency combs with minimal initial investment and offers the flexibility to easily switch signal sources depending on the application or environment.
By passing the Frush output through a high-power EDFA and a highly nonlinear optical fiber, the optical comb spectrum can be broadened to several tens of nanometers and compressed to sub-picosecond pulse durations. Additionally, Frush enables advanced functionalities such as phase-locking two narrow-linewidth lasers separated by approximately 300 GHz. Specifications
- Center wavelength: 1550 ± 20 nm
- -20 dB spectral width: > 200 GHz
- Average output power: > -5 dBm at 13 dBm optical input
- Pulse duration: ≦ 6 ps (Compressed)
- Comb spacing: 12 to 18 GHz (Factory default fixed)
- Input/Output fiber port: FC/APC
- Polarization: Linearly polarization is possible
- Size H×W×D: 148×480×430 mm
